Proper name [Latin]

IPA: /ˈkar.tʰa.da/ [Classical-Latin], [ˈkärt̪ʰäd̪ä] [Classical-Latin], /ˈkar.ta.da/ (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ical), [ˈkärt̪äd̪ä] (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ical)
Etymology: Uncertain; ultimately from Phoenician 𐤒𐤓𐤕-𐤇𐤃𐤔𐤕 (qrt-ḥdšt, “new city”). Doublet of Carchēdōn, Carthāgō, and Carthago Nova.   1. (rare) Synonym of Carthāgō (“Carthage”) Tags: declension-1, feminine, rare, singular Synonyms: Carthāgō [synonym, synonym-of]
